Answer:

In Taj Mahal, we can find the work of Pietras Dura.

Explanation:

"Pietras Dura" is the technique of using colored stones such as precious, semi precious and gem stones to create patterns in buildings. This technique was first used in 16th century in Rome and later developed in Florence, Italy. It is also known as "Parchin kari" and is an Italian phrase that translates to "strong stone" in English. Other monuments which used this technique were "Tomb of Itmad-Ud-Daulah" and "Tomb of Jahanghir".
